Will a tilted uterus make it harder to get pregnant?


B. Jacobs, M. D. - July 25th, 2006 6:27 PM

Approximately 40% of women have a "tilted" uterus. How can it be abnormal if almost half the population has it? If it really made a difference, what do you think the world's population would be? Your "tilted" uterus is not a problem. If you are having difficulty becoming pregnant, go to a Reproductive Endocrinologist, not an OB.
